And what exactly makes IB so miserable to play?
IB isn't miserable to play, it just isn't good. People say it gets hate because its hard to play but bg is the same thing, except the stuff bg has is actually good for all levels of play.

IB has a lot of buffs that just dont stack w/ knight/sm stuff and doesn't bring anything unique to the table for order groups besides an armor debuff for melee groups w/o white lions, and some powerful single target buffs for mdps. It's a good tank in double slayer 6v6/sc groups, or if for whatever reason you run wh+Slayer instead. It's been bad for a very long time and desperately needs the same treatment that BG got but because we got a bunch of IB players on this server getting high off the smell of their own farts they actively campaigned against anything being done to the class on several occasions and certainly aren't going to speak up after most people gave up trying.

If you like the IB playstyle which is pretty refreshing especially compared to knight/chosen gameplay but want to play something that is good at all levels of play and doesn't have a problem finding spots in groups just play BG.

IB needs some serious love when it comes to 24v24/city scale, and in terms of small scale it either needs some buffs or more nerfbat on knight/SM there or we have to see WH/DPS WP get some serious buffs for what IB brings to a 6 man to shine more. IB was the meta off tank on live for pretty much ever but the go to melee train was also wh+Slayer, WL was a meme class and groups on order didn't have the luxury of armor buffs all over the place like destro has so that IB armor debuff was crucial.

Want to also say that unlike live, we have a PvP city here. 24v24 actually matters and as much **** as it might get from the playerbase the devs achieved a good end to the campaign instead of the retarded FIND EMPTY INSTANCE PvE freefarm on live. We also dont have hyper inflated gear progression and people actually care about gear instead of just having it handed to them well before they could ever achieve the RR to wear it.

But that also means people actually CARE if their class is good in largescale/24v24 unlike before when the only thing that really mattered to hardcore players was "can i fit into a 6 man ?".

This is why you are seeing a lot of new heated balance discussion this year with the release of city. And in terms of tanks IB is undisputably at the bottom rung for tanks in this area.

And what exactly makes IB so miserable to play?
I read the other day someone put it that IB is a "piano class" which is true. Where some classes have a small rotation of buttons based on single target vs aoe situations, IB really has to use many more buttons to get the most out of the class. Furthermore the buffs provided don't provide the same overall benefit that a Knight aura does and the duration of the IB buffs tend to be kind of short so it you do a lot of work for not much benefit compared to knight.
